The 18th century saw radical change in all aspects of French life in a period which became known as the Age of Enlightenment. In literature French writers began to explore ideas that reflected the new found liberty. The libertine, or erotic novel, featured eroticism, seduction, manipulation, and social intrigue. Classic examples such as Les Liaisons dangereuses by Pierre Choderlos de Laclos (1782) and Justine ou les Malheurs de la vertu by the infamous Marquis de Sade often were accompanied by illustrated plates and this led in turn to an interest in erotic art.
